High profile location at the corner of historic South Michigan Avenue and
Roosevelt Road (1200 South), at the gateway to the booming South
Loop. This area is in the midst of very rapid development, accounting for
nearly 50% of all new condominium and townhouse sales in Chicago in
2005 & 2006. Over 6,000 residential units were recently completed,
including the Central Station and Dearborn Park planned communities,
and nearly 10,000 additional units are planned in the area in major
developments such as the new Roosevelt Collection, Prairie Station and
Riverside District developments.
It is located less than 1 mile from Chicago’s main downtown “Loop”
business district. The Museum Campus and Soldier Field are just 2
blocks to the east. Numerous new “big box” retail stores have opened
recently along Roosevelt Road to the west including Target, Jewel/Osco,
Dominick’s, Whole Foods, Home Depot, Best Buy, Walgreen’s, Linens N’
Things, Office Depot, DSW and many others. It is also less than a mile
from McCormick Place, the 2nd highest volume convention center in the
country.
This site has outstanding access to all major transportation modes,
including Lake Shore Drive, 1/8th mile to the east, the Dan Ryan
Expressway (I-90/94), less than 1 mile to the west, and only 2 blocks to
both elevated and subway train stations on Roosevelt Road and 2 blocks
to the South Shore Metra train line.
